Concert for Kerry Edwards Victory '04 WHEN: October 17 @ 7:00 PM WHERE: Maplewood Women's Club 60 Woodland Road Maplewood, NJ 07040 Maplewood/South Orange, NJ Featuring: Marshall Crenshaw, The Roches, Odetta, Tickets: $100/General $250 & $500 To purchase tickets online, go to: https://www.democrats.org/support/kev065.html For more information, contact KerryConcertSOMA@aol.com Or visit the concert web site: http://www.maplewood.net/ConcertforKerryEdwards04/

General admission tickets (selling VERY fast, almost 1/4 gone three days after on sale) are $100. The sponsor tickets are $250 each and include an invitation to an after-concert party with the performers, including the Roche Sisters (all three in their first reunion in over five years), Marshall Crenshaw, Odetta, Iris DeMent and Greg Brown. |
